Output 818c270ee9de8f405c7aae6af24c3a4fb47b88e18c7d91aae852caf7aeadeaf8:2

value
32825259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 773894c9328dde97409967f18416f4177af9861b OP_EQUAL
address
3CZQ7hfXhdC96qoaytg9kJQir6ezGpxaWh
transaction
818c270ee9de8f405c7aae6af24c3a4fb47b88e18c7d91aae852caf7aeadeaf8
confirmations
372486
spent
true